Establishing a Budget

One of the essential factors in finding the perfect rental home is determining your budget. Carefully assess your financial situation, factoring in rent, utilities, and potential additional costs like maintenance and renters' insurance. Establishing a realistic budget will help you narrow down your options and avoid overspending.

Location, Location, Location

The location of your rental property is crucial. Consider proximity to work, schools, public transportation, and amenities like grocery stores, parks, and healthcare facilities. Research neighborhoods thoroughly to ensure they align with your lifestyle and safety requirements.

Amenities and Features

Create a checklist of amenities and features that are vital to your ideal lifestyle. This might include the number of bedrooms and bathrooms, a spacious kitchen, a backyard, or even a pet-friendly policy. Be clear about your must-haves and your nice-to-haves.

Inspecting the Property

Once you've identified potential rental properties, schedule viewings to inspect them in person. Pay close attention to the condition of the house, including any maintenance or repair needs. Take note of the neighborhood's atmosphere and safety, as well as the accessibility of local services and schools.

Understanding the Lease

Before signing on the dotted line, thoroughly review the lease agreement. Understand the terms, including the duration of the lease, rent amount and due date, security deposit, and any maintenance responsibilities. If you have questions or concerns, don't hesitate to seek clarification from the landlord or property management.

The Application Process

When you find the perfect single-family house, it's time to apply. Be prepared to provide personal and financial information, as well as references. A strong application can help you stand out in competitive rental markets.

Moving In and Settling Down

Congratulations on securing your ideal rental home! As you move in, take inventory of the property's condition and document any existing issues. Settle into your new space, personalize it to your liking, and embrace the lifestyle you've envisioned.
